How @plasma and $XPL Are Redefining Stablecoin Settlement with High-Performance Blockchain Design
As stablecoins become a central part of global crypto payments, the need for a blockchain purpose-built for fast, efficient settlement is becoming clear. Many existing networks were not originally designed with stablecoin usage in mind, which often leads to congestion, unpredictable fees, and slow confirmations. This is where @Plasma introduces a different approach by creating a Layer 1 blockchain specifically optimized for stablecoin transactions, powered by $XPL and focused on real performance. #Plasma A key strength of this network is its full EVM compatibility combined with sub-second finality. This allows developers to deploy familiar smart contracts while benefiting from extremely fast confirmation times. For payment systems and financial applications that rely on stablecoins like USDT, speed and reliability are essential. Plasma’s architecture ensures that transactions are processed efficiently without the delays commonly seen on other chains. Another important innovation is the concept of stablecoin-first gas and gasless USDT transfers. This design makes the user experience simpler and more practical, especially in regions where stablecoins are widely used for everyday transactions. Instead of requiring users to hold a separate token just to pay fees, the network prioritizes stablecoin usability, making blockchain interactions feel closer to traditional digital payments. Security and neutrality are also addressed through Bitcoin-anchored design principles, enhancing censorship resistance and trust in the system. This combination of performance, usability, and security positions @undefined as a strong candidate for real-world financial and payment applications. The role of $XPL goes beyond simple transaction fees. It supports network participation, governance, and ecosystem growth as more developers and institutions explore stablecoin-based solutions. As blockchain adoption continues to move toward practical financial use cases, platforms designed specifically for settlement and payments will play a critical role. By focusing on stablecoin efficiency, developer compatibility, and fast finality, @undefined is not just another Layer 1 competing on general features. It is building a specialized infrastructure that addresses one of the most important and rapidly growing use cases in crypto today, powered by $XPL and designed for the future of digital payments.

Privacy, Compliance, and the Future of Financial Blockchain Infrastructure
As blockchain adoption grows across industries, one major concern continues to slow institutional participation: the lack of privacy combined with regulatory requirements. Public chains provide transparency, but for financial institutions, enterprises, and real-world assets, complete openness is often not practical. This is where @Dusk introduces a unique approach by designing a blockchain that balances confidentiality with compliance, powered by $DUSK and purpose-built for real financial use cases. #dusk Traditional blockchains allow anyone to trace transactions and wallet activity, which creates challenges for businesses handling sensitive financial data. The need for a network that can protect transaction details while still offering verifiability has become essential. This project addresses that gap by using advanced cryptographic methods that allow validation of data without revealing the data itself, enabling private smart contract execution. A key strength of this ecosystem is how it focuses on regulated environments such as digital securities, asset tokenization, and compliant decentralized finance. Instead of choosing between decentralization and regulation, the architecture is designed to support both. This makes the platform attractive for institutions exploring blockchain solutions without exposing confidential user or business information. The token plays an important role in securing the network, participating in governance, and incentivizing validators to maintain performance and integrity. As adoption of privacy-preserving blockchain infrastructure increases, the value of networks that can serve institutional and enterprise needs becomes more apparent. Developers also benefit from an environment where they can build applications that meet real-world standards. Applications created here can maintain user privacy while still offering transparency where required, something that is difficult to achieve on most public chains. As the industry moves forward, solutions that combine privacy, scalability, and compliance will define the next stage of blockchain evolution. This approach demonstrates how blockchain can be practical for finance, enterprises, and users who need both security and regulatory alignment without compromising decentralization.
